The poster uses all warm, earthy tones—primarily light brown and sand colors as the background. At the center, a stylized composition is visible: five asymmetrical, elongated shapes directed from bottom to top, resembling rods or spears emerging from a single point. On the left side beneath them, a small symbol highlighted in red is placed, resembling a sun or flower motif, around which a triangular white element is arranged. In the lower part, large, irregular white texts cut in the shape of letters dominate on the brown background, forming two lines. At the top and bottom of the poster, smaller, finer letter-like inscriptions are visible. The entire composition is simple yet dynamic, with a pronounced vertical orientation.
